
Is it true? Watch those embellishments. A story can be made more interesting if we stray from the facts.
Is it kind? Watch that ‘schandenfreude’. A story isn’t kind when told at someone else’s expense as a way to elevate ourselves.
Is it necessary (useful)? This one is the biggest challenge. Most stories aren’t necessary as far as life and death is concerned. We tell them to enrich our lives and the lives of others, hopefully in useful ways. Be sure to clear out the negatives before accepting the usefulness.
One way to monitor ourselves is by asking, “If the person about whom I’m telling this story were here, would I tell it in this exact way?” If the answer is ‘yes’, go for it; your answers have passed the ‘Three Sieves Test.’
